Renumber x86 registers
Now that there's no hazard to using a register used for passing arguments, renumber to give JIT_R/JIT_F/JIT_V names to all registers. Choose a temp register that's not used for passing arguments. Our previous choice was an argument register (doh!) which made function calls with many arguments fail.

diff --git a/tests/call_10.c b/tests/call_10.c
new file mode 100644
index 000000000..9c3c94358
--- /dev/null
+++ b/tests/call_10.c
@@ -0,0 +1,52 @@
+#include "test.h"
+
+static int32_t f(int32_t a, int32_t b, int32_t c, int32_t d, int32_t e,
+ int32_t f, int32_t g, int32_t h, int32_t i, int32_t j) {
+ ASSERT(a == 0);
+ ASSERT(b == 1);
+ ASSERT(c == 2);
+ ASSERT(d == 3);
+ ASSERT(e == 4);
+ ASSERT(f == 5);
+ ASSERT(g == 6);
+ ASSERT(h == 7);
+ ASSERT(i == 8);
+ ASSERT(j == 9);
+ return 42;
+}
+
+static void
+run_test(jit_state_t *j, uint8_t *arena_base, size_t arena_size)
+{
+ jit_begin(j, arena_base, arena_size);
+ jit_load_args_1(j, jit_operand_gpr (JIT_OPERAND_ABI_POINTER, JIT_R0));
+
+ jit_operand_t args[10] = {
+ jit_operand_mem(JIT_OPERAND_ABI_INT32, JIT_R0, 0 * sizeof(int32_t)),
+ jit_operand_mem(JIT_OPERAND_ABI_INT32, JIT_R0, 1 * sizeof(int32_t)),
+ jit_operand_mem(JIT_OPERAND_ABI_INT32, JIT_R0, 2 * sizeof(int32_t)),
+ jit_operand_mem(JIT_OPERAND_ABI_INT32, JIT_R0, 3 * sizeof(int32_t)),
+ jit_operand_mem(JIT_OPERAND_ABI_INT32, JIT_R0, 4 * sizeof(int32_t)),
+ jit_operand_mem(JIT_OPERAND_ABI_INT32, JIT_R0, 5 * sizeof(int32_t)),
+ jit_operand_mem(JIT_OPERAND_ABI_INT32, JIT_R0, 6 * sizeof(int32_t)),
+ jit_operand_mem(JIT_OPERAND_ABI_INT32, JIT_R0, 7 * sizeof(int32_t)),
+ jit_operand_mem(JIT_OPERAND_ABI_INT32, JIT_R0, 8 * sizeof(int32_t)),
+ jit_operand_mem(JIT_OPERAND_ABI_INT32, JIT_R0, 9 * sizeof(int32_t))
+ };
+ jit_calli(j, f, 10, args);
+ jit_ret(j);
+
+ size_t size = 0;
+ void* ret = jit_end(j, &size);
+
+ int32_t (*f)(int32_t*) = ret;
+
+ int32_t iargs[10] = { 0, 1, 2, 3, 4, 5, 6, 7, 8, 9 };
+ ASSERT(f(iargs) == 42);
+}
+
+int
+main (int argc, char *argv[])
+{
+ return main_helper(argc, argv, run_test);
+}
